Abstract

The utility model discloses a three-dimensional welfare breeding house, which comprises a breeding house main body, a feed conveying line and a drinking water conveying line, wherein a plurality of layers of breeding platforms are arranged in the breeding house main body, a plurality of groups of dung leaking plates are arranged on each layer of breeding platform, a first dung belt is arranged below the dung leaking plates, a second dung belt is arranged at one end below the first dung belt, a conveying line is arranged at one end below the second dung belt, and the conveying line is connected with the breeding house main body and a dung shed; a feed tray, a drinking water tray and welfare facilities are arranged above the excrement leaking plate. The advantages are that: the culture platform is a through-laying platform and at least comprises two layers, so that the culture space can be reasonably utilized, the culture amount is increased, and the cost is saved; first hourglass dropping board, second leak dropping board and first excrement area, second excrement area, transfer chain make things convenient for the transfer, the transport and the collection of chicken manure, reduce the ammonia in the house, provide better living environment for the chicken coop. The welfare facility simulates the facility in the natural stocking state, increases the activity space of the chicken and improves the quality of the chicken.

Background
With the continuous development of science and technology, chicken breeding technology is also continuously improved, and breeding can be divided into stocking, henhouse breeding and mixed breeding. The chicken coop breeding has the characteristics of large scale, intensification and industrialization, and is the main mode of chicken breeding at present. Traditional chicken coop directly raises the chicken subaerial, and not only the number of breeding the chicken is less relatively in unit area, breeds the chicken and does not carry out the separation with excrement and urine moreover, and the chicken coop health problem is anxious. The existing double-layer henhouse has very high equipment investment and operation cost, and daily management needs a large amount of manpower and material resources. The chicken coop also needs to simulate the natural stocking state, and welfare facilities are added for the chickens to play and peck in hands, and the welfare facilities in the existing chicken coop are not perfect.
Patent document CN217117230U discloses a double-deck chicken coop, including a plurality of chicken coop units, the level sets up two-layer fretwork baffle in the chicken coop wall body of chicken coop unit, the top space of fretwork baffle is one deck chicken coop and two-deck chicken coop promptly, fretwork baffle below all is provided with the manure receiving tank, the manure receiving tank is interior arc, sewage pipes has been seted up to the axis department of manure receiving tank, sewage pipes's one end is higher than the other end, and the low-lying end of one deck and two-deck sewage pipes links to each other through vertical pipeline, the top both ends of manure receiving tank all are provided with the cleaning tube, a set of opposite flank of chicken coop wall body is provided with a plurality of fans, and chicken coop door has been seted up to one of them side, another group of opposite flank is provided with a plurality of mosquito trap lamps. Although a layer of breeding space can be added to the double-layer henhouse, the breeding space needs to be partitioned by a plurality of henhouse roofs and henhouse walls, and the henhouse is high in construction cost; the inner arc-shaped septic tank and the sewage pipes with one ends higher than the other ends need to be cleaned by means of water spray nozzles, and the chicken manure is easy to accumulate in the sewage pipes and needs to be washed by a large amount of water, so that the cleaning is not thorough, and the water consumption is large.

Detailed Description
The present invention will be further explained with reference to the embodiments of the drawings.
Example one
As shown in fig. 1-8: the three-dimensional welfare breeding house comprises a breeding house main body 1, a feed conveying line 2 and a drinking water conveying line 3, wherein a plurality of layers of breeding platforms 4 are arranged in the breeding house main body 1, a dung leaking plate 5 is arranged on each layer of breeding platform 4, a first dung belt 6 is arranged below the dung leaking plate 5, a second dung belt 7 is further arranged below one end of the first dung belt 6, a conveying line 8 is further arranged below one end of the second dung belt 7, and the conveying line 8 is connected with the breeding house main body 1 and a dung shed 9;
a cross beam 10 perpendicular to the first manure belt 6 is further arranged below the manure leaking plate 5, and a support frame 11 parallel to the first manure belt 6 is arranged below the cross beam 10; the supporting frames 11 comprise an upper layer and a lower layer, and a connecting plate 12 is arranged between the two layers of the supporting frames 11; and rollers 13 are arranged between the upper layer supporting frame 11 and the first manure belt 6 at intervals, and the rollers 13 can reduce the resistance of the first manure belt 6 in the running process.
A plurality of groups of fodder trays 14 and water drinking trays 15 are arranged above the excrement leaking plate 5, the fodder conveying lines 2 are communicated with the fodder trays 14, and the water drinking conveying lines 3 are communicated with the water drinking trays 15; above the manure leaking plate 5, between each group of feed trays 14 and drinking water trays 15, a welfare facility 16 is further provided, the welfare facility 16 comprising a perch 161, a bale 162 and a pecking toy 163.
The dung leaking plate 5 is a grid dung leaking plate and comprises a first dung leaking plate 51 and a second dung leaking plate 52, and the grid size of the first dung leaking plate 51 is larger than that of the second dung leaking plate 52. The second dung leaking plate 52 can be used as a brooding area for breeding the chickens with smaller sizes due to smaller grids; the first dropping-leaking plate 51 has larger grid size and can be used for breeding the chickens with larger sizes.
The culture platform 4 is a through-laying platform, and the culture platform 4 at least comprises two layers; the through-laying platform reduces the construction cost of the henhouse and provides a larger moving space for the chickens.
The first dung belt 6 is a longitudinal dung belt, and the second dung belt 7 is a transverse dung belt; and the longitudinal manure belt 6 is wound outside the upper and lower layers of the support frames 11. The longitudinal manure belt 6 and the transverse manure belt 7 are both conveyor belts, transmission shafts 17 are arranged at two ends of each conveyor belt, and a power device is arranged on the transmission shaft 17 at the front end of each conveyor belt. The vertical manure belt 6 can effectively bear the chicken manure falling from the manure leaking plate 5, the chicken manure is conveyed to the conveying line 8 after being conveyed, and the conveying line 8 conveys the chicken manure to the manure shed 9 for collection and further treatment. For the first manure belt 6, the second manure belt 7 and the conveying line 8, different times can be selected according to the output condition of the chicken manure, the work is started manually, and the chicken manure is transferred; reduce ammonia gas in the house and provide a better living environment for the chicken flocks. After a batch of chickens are bred and all the chickens are out of the house, the first manure belt 6, the second manure belt 7 and the conveying line 8 can be cleaned by water, and the next batch of chickens are bred after the first manure belt, the second manure belt and the conveying line are cleaned.
The roost 161 is a bridge type roost or a tripod type roost, as shown in fig. 6-9, 1 tripod type roost with a length of two meters is arranged in the moving area of every 1000 chickens, and a mesh enclosure can be arranged on the tripod type roost to facilitate the chickens to climb; 1-1.5 bridge type roosts, and the bridge type roosts can also be provided with a mesh enclosure, so that chickens can climb conveniently, the activity space of the chickens is increased, and the chickens are prevented from being injured due to extrusion. The bales 162 are woven bags filled with rice hulls or hay, and 30-40 bales can be arranged in the first layer of cultivation platform 4 for chickens to play; the pecking toy 163 comprises hay bundles 1631, a cushion box 1634, a water bottle 1632 and balls 1633, wherein 24-36 hay bundles can be arranged in the first layer of cultivation platform 4 for the chickens to peck; 20-30 cushion boxes 1634 are arranged, rice hulls are placed in the cushion boxes 1634, and the chickens, particularly chicks, can play with the cushion boxes; 20-30 water bottles or round balls are hung by a thin rope for the chickens to peck. The perch 161, the bale 162, and the pecking toy 163 serve as welfare facilities, simulate facilities in a natural stocking state, increase activity items of chickens, and particularly improve the quality of chicken meat for broilers.
